The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for remote or hybrid work requiring Node.js sk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 25 April 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
25 Apr 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 124 65 94
Rank change year-on-year -59 +29 -36
Permanent jobs citing Node.js 376 578 1,034
As % of all permanent jobs with remote/hybrid work options 2.09% 4.28% 3.18%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 11.85% 14.40% 12.10%
Number of salaries quoted 309 428 906
10th Percentile £50,000 £48,375 £42,500
25th Percentile £57,500 £55,000 £50,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£72,500 £72,500 £67,500
Median % change year-on-year - +7.41% -4.37%
75th Percentile £100,000 £97,500 £83,750
90th Percentile £142,500 £125,000 £100,000
UK median annual salary £75,000 £70,000 £65,000
% change year-on-year +7.14% +7.69% -7.14%
